If you decide to buy here, definitely play hard and get the developer to fix everything before closing. The customer care team is not very proactive about responding or fixing issues after moving in--their favorite excuse is that the issues are "within tolerance" and will try to avoid fixing it. Also, hire an agent to represent yourself as the buyer! There's no cost to you (seller pays the agent out of the proceeds), and it will be nice to have an agent on your side.

Besides that..it's overall a nice place to live. They are building numerous parks as the neighborhood gets built out. Neighbors here are generally friendly, and you see a lot of people walking their dogs in the evenings. Great views from select units.
